Electrical Insulation
One of the primary functions of power generation equipment is to generate and transmit electricity. However, electrical currents can be dangerous if they're not properly controlled. That's where Mechanical Insulating Rubber Strips come in. These strips can be used to insulate electrical components, such as wires, cables, and terminals, to prevent electrical shocks and short circuits. They can also be used to isolate different electrical circuits within the equipment, reducing the risk of interference and improving overall performance.
Thermal Insulation
Power generation equipment generates a lot of heat during operation. If this heat isn't properly managed, it can cause damage to the equipment and reduce its efficiency. Mechanical Insulating Rubber Strips can help to solve this problem by providing thermal insulation. They can be used to line the walls of generators, turbines, and other equipment to reduce heat transfer and keep the internal temperature within a safe range. This not only protects the equipment but also improves its energy efficiency.
Vibration and Noise Dampening
Power generation equipment often produces a lot of vibration and noise during operation. This can be a nuisance for workers and nearby residents, and it can also cause damage to the equipment over time. Mechanical Insulating Rubber Strips can help to reduce vibration and noise by acting as a buffer between different components of the equipment. They can be used to isolate vibrating parts, such as motors and pumps, and absorb the energy of the vibrations, reducing their amplitude and frequency. This not only makes the equipment quieter but also extends its lifespan.
Chemical Resistance
Power generation equipment is often exposed to a variety of chemicals, such as oils, fuels, and coolants. These chemicals can cause damage to the equipment if they're not properly contained. Mechanical Insulating Rubber Strips are resistant to many chemicals, making them an ideal choice for use in power generation equipment. They can be used to seal joints and connections to prevent chemical leaks and protect the equipment from corrosion and damage.
Flexibility and Durability
Power generation equipment is often subject to mechanical stresses, such as bending, stretching, and compression. Mechanical Insulating Rubber Strips are flexible and can withstand these stresses without losing their insulating properties. They're also durable and can last for a long time, even in harsh environments. This makes them a reliable and cost-effective solution for use in power generation equipment.

Generator Sealing
Generators are one of the most important components of power generation equipment. They convert mechanical energy into electrical energy, and they need to be properly sealed to prevent the leakage of air, water, and other fluids. Mechanical Insulating Rubber Strips can be used to seal the joints and connections of generators, ensuring a tight and secure fit. They can also be used to insulate the electrical components of the generator, reducing the risk of electrical shocks and short circuits.
Turbine Insulation
Turbines are another critical component of power generation equipment. They use steam, gas, or water to generate mechanical energy, which is then converted into electrical energy. Turbines operate at high temperatures and pressures, and they need to be properly insulated to prevent heat loss and improve efficiency. Mechanical Insulating Rubber Strips can be used to line the walls of turbines, providing thermal insulation and reducing heat transfer. They can also be used to seal the joints and connections of turbines, preventing the leakage of steam, gas, or water.
Transformer Insulation
Transformers are used to step up or step down the voltage of electrical currents. They operate at high voltages and temperatures, and they need to be properly insulated to prevent electrical breakdown and ensure safe operation. Mechanical Insulating Rubber Strips can be used to insulate the windings and other electrical components of transformers, reducing the risk of electrical shocks and short circuits. They can also be used to seal the joints and connections of transformers, preventing the leakage of oil and other fluids.
Cable and Wire Insulation
Power generation equipment uses a lot of cables and wires to transmit electricity. These cables and wires need to be properly insulated to prevent electrical shocks and short circuits. Mechanical Insulating Rubber Strips can be used to insulate the cables and wires, providing a protective barrier against electrical currents. They can also be used to seal the joints and connections of cables and wires, preventing the ingress of moisture and other contaminants.
